Juanma Moreno accuses Sánchez of “plagiarizing” social measures of the Junta de Andalucía: “An excellent time”

The president of the Junta de Andalucía, Juanma Moreno, has accused the president of the central government, Pedro Sánchez, of “plagiarizing” the social measures of the Andalusian authorities.

The Government introduced it this Sunday. A line of ensures, by way of the Official Credit Institute (ICO), to ensure 20 p.c of the mortgage of a primary house for younger folks beneath 35 years of age with an annual revenue of lower than 37,800 euros and for households with dependent youngsters.

Through a publication on his Twitter profile, Moreno has indicated that “as we speak Sánchez publicizes the ensures for younger folks when it comes to housing that we launched a very long time in the past in Andalusia as an amazing thought,” he factors out.

“A variety of criticizing the PP, however then they plagiarize our social measures. Good occasions,” provides the Andalusian president who accompanies the tweet with a picture of Sánchez’s announcement, dated May 7, 2023, and one other dated May 10. January of this identical 12 months, when the Board proposed endorsing 15 p.c of the quantity of the mortgage for these beneath 35 years of age with an preliminary price range of 20 million euros.

It is the mechanism often known as ‘Help to purchase’, a formulation that will increase from 80% to 95% or 100% the quantity that banks finance a mortgage and that has been working within the United Kingdom since 2013.
